Output 903f4e9121b7ca645d2aec29a14e6a1306def53c174299826ad904981f893d41:1

value
590855
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a5bdc4a36cf6b1abc326c214ae8032f2d642b427 OP_EQUALVERIFY OP_CHECKSIG
address
mvdK82TzDHcAziK4arvPJFakzMxdePTz9z
transaction
903f4e9121b7ca645d2aec29a14e6a1306def53c174299826ad904981f893d41
spent
true